Job description

  • Designs, develops, implements, and oversees the organization's environmental health and safety programs and procedures to safeguard employees and surrounding communities and to ensure that facility is in compliance with regulations.
  • Conducts studies and investigations to ensure compliance with government safety and health laws, standards and regulations and industrial hygiene as well as environmental safety.
  • Investigates accidents and promotes safety-conscious work performance and training programs.
  • Provides safety performance measures.
  • Responsible for delivery of professional safety activities by applying standard safety techniques and procedures.
  • Responsible for planning own work, assessing own progress and adjusting efforts to meet goals.
  • Determines root cause analyses.

What You'll Need

  • Bachelor’s degree in safety science, safety management, industrial hygiene, environmental science, occupational health, engineering or other industrial discipline work experience preferred.
  • Equivalent work experience of 3-5 years in an Industrial/Manufacturing Environment
  • Knowledge of:
    • Occupational Safety & Health Administration (OSHA)
    • Environmental Protection Agency (EPA)
    • Workers Compensation regulations
  • Ability to deal with situations involving sensitive and confidential company information
  •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to prioritize and complete multiple projects in a timely manner
  • Ability to make decisions and operate independently with respect to complex issues and business requirements.
Working Conditions

  • Work environment includes plant, warehouse, production and non-production areas and plant grounds.
  • Ability to tolerate both high and low temperatures, loud noises typical of a manufacturing plant.
  • Prolonged periods sitting at a desk and working on a computer.
  • Must be able to lift to 15 pounds at times.
